- Osvaldo Golijov was born on December 5, 1960 in La Plata, Argentina. He is a composer, known for The Man Who Cried (2000), Youth Without Youth (2007) and The Oath (2010).
- 2003 MacArthur Fellow with a $500,000 "no strings attached" funds over the next five years.
- Associate Professor at College of the Holy Cross in Worcester, MA, where he has taught since 1991, and is also on the faculty of the Boston Conservatory.
- Ph.d in Music Composition from University of Pennsylvania where he studied with George Crumb.
- Studied with Mark Kopytman at the Jerusalem Rubin Academy.
- In 2000, commissioned by German Helmuth Rilling for $10,000 to write a Passion based on St. Mark to commemorate the 250th anniversary of the death of Johann Sebastian Bach in 2000.
